Hey plugin folks! If your plugin hooks into Permafrost's archiving pipeline, you'll need a few env vars set before anything moves to cold storage. ARCHIVE_BUCKET_PREFIX controls where frozen objects land, and ARCHIVE_AGE_DAYS decides when objects qualify (default is 90 — don't go lower than 30 or the lifecycle checker gets cranky). Compression is on by default; flip ARCHIVE_COMPRESS to off if your plugin pre-compresses. Once those are in your env file, add the archive-write credential secret on the very next line.

env line for hahap-yahap: RELAY_SECRET20=ddd9a6e229d82513cc5d

Key ceremony checklist — item 7: cron drift follow-up

Before we sign off, double-check the cron drift thing on the Tallowmere batch hosts. The jobs that schedule ceremony key rotation were firing 40 minutes late last week — turned out the NTP source on rack B was flaky. Reviewer: confirm the fix commit landed and the drift alert is green in Spanlight. Once that's verified, the sealed backup can be re-initialized, which prompts for the recovery passphrase.

unlock words, tawif-tahop: oliys-ulawyn-tamdor-lamys-casox-jormir-fraius-kasath-ulador-ulamir-holir-sorys-holeth

## Authentication

Heads up: the nightly reindex job (`reindex_nightly.py`) talks to the Lanternfish search cluster, and that cluster won't accept anonymous writes anymore — we locked it down last sprint. The job now authenticates as the `reindex-runner` service identity against Corvid Gateway, and the token is injected via the `LF_INDEX_TOKEN` env var in the scheduler config. Nothing clever going on, just a bearer header on every batch request. For review purposes, the staging credential currently in use is listed below.

service key, kadug-kadup: kto15_rN23XLAYImmZgrJ

Account Recovery — Pagewright Static Builds

If a customer loses access to their Pagewright dashboard, incremental rebuilds of their static site will continue from the last known-good deploy, so no content is lost during recovery. Confirm the customer's last rebuild timestamp in the Orlin console, then initiate the recovery flow from the admin panel. Do not trigger a full rebuild until access is restored. Unlocking the recovery flow requires the passphrase below.

recovery phrase for yadup-taguf: wenael-quenox-kelix